Basque Country Interior Road Trip Itinerary

The Basque Country Interior Road Trip is an unforgettable journey through some of the most picturesque parts of Spain. Starting in the city of Bilbao, this 228km route winds its way through the towns of Durango, Otxandio, Elorrio, Onati, and Tolosa, offering up stunning views and plenty of attractions along the way. The best time to take this journey is during the warmer months of the year, when the rolling hills and lush valleys of the Basque Country come alive with vibrant greens and blues. However, the excellent road conditions make it a great trip all year round. The route is mostly a straight highway, with some curvy roads in between, making it suitable for drivers of all levels. It is estimated to take around two days to complete, with plenty of opportunities to stop and explore the local culture and cuisine. With a moderate budget, this road trip can provide a very high level of experience and memories. So, if you’re looking for a unique way to explore the Basque Country, the Basque Country Interior Road Trip is the perfect choice.

Bilbao is an ideal starting point for an unforgettable road trip through the Basque Country. Located in the heart of the Bay of Biscay, this vibrant city will captivate you with its unique blend of architecture, culture and gastronomy. Bilbao's main airport, Bilbao Airport (BIO), is conveniently located and offers car rental services from various suppliers. Once you have your car, you can start exploring the city and its surrounding area. A must-see is the iconic Guggenheim Museum, which houses an impressive collection of modern and contemporary art. The nearby Zubizuri bridge is also worth visiting, with its distinctive curved shape and glass walkway. For those looking to get a taste of the local culture, head to the Casco Viejo, the old quarter of the city, where you can find traditional Basque restaurants, lively bars and local craft shops. San Sebastián is a beautiful city located in the Basque Country in northern Spain. It is the perfect ending point for the Basque Country Interior Road Trip, a great journey that takes travelers from Bilbao to San Sebastián. San Sebastián is known for its beaches, which offer great opportunities for both swimming and sunbathing. The city is also home to one of the best urban beaches in the world, La Concha Beach. The city has plenty of other attractions to explore, such as the old town, La Parte Vieja, which offers a great mix of old and modern buildings. The city also has a vibrant cultural scene, with numerous museums, galleries, and theaters. For nature lovers, San Sebastián offers plenty of opportunities to explore. The nearby mountains offer great hiking and mountain biking trails, while the city has numerous parks and gardens to explore. The city is also home to numerous traditional Basque dishes, such as pintxos, which are small snacks served in bars. For those traveling by air, the closest international airport is located in Bilbao (BIO). From there, it is a short drive to San Sebastián. Facts for safer driving in Spain

drink drive limit drink drive limit 0.5
max speed urban max speed urban 50 km/h
max speed rural max speed rural 100 km/h
max speed highway max speed highway 120 km/h
headlights at daytime headlights at daytime off
fire extinguisher fire extinguisher no
tolls tolls yes
seat belts seat belts yes
